According to a report from Economic Information Agency on the 14th, Wang He announced a voluntary cash partial acquisition offer with attached conditions to acquire approximately 56.32 million shares of TONTINE WINES (00389), accounting for about 18.68% of the equity, at an offer price of HKD 0.20 per share, which represents a discount of approximately 44.4% compared to the last trading price of HKD 0.36, involving a total investment of about HKD 11.264 million.
The cash consideration that the offeror must pay under the partial acquisition offer amounts to approximately HKD 11.264 million. Currently, Wang He and his concert parties hold about 11.22% of the equity, and if the offer is fully accepted, their shareholding will increase to 29.9%. Wang He is currently the controlling shareholder, director, and general manager of Bohan Investment. Bohan Investment is engaged in investment activities, investing in private and listed companies in China and Hong Kong.
The offeror is a major shareholder of TONTINE WINES and is optimistic about the business development of the target company. Therefore, the offeror intends to increase its voting rights in the target company through the partial acquisition offer, in order to have a greater influence on the corporate behavior, transactions, and director nominations of the target company and its management.
